IRM 3305 - RISK MGT THEORY & PRACTICE

Institution:
University of Houston-Downtown
Subject:
Insurance & Risk Management
Description:
Capstone course which integrates the risk management process for handling business risks faced by organizations including property and liability risks, employee benefit planning, and international loss exposures, with an emphasis on risk identification and evaluation together with alternative methods of risk control and risk financing techniques.
